Nuance
Taare-qafas evokes the imagery of confinement within beauty. The stars, symbols of hope and dreams, become the very bars that imprison, creating a paradox of freedom and captivity.
Poetic Usage
Poets use 'taare-qafas' to express the duality of beauty and entrapment. It reflects on how aspirations can both elevate and confine.
